BRISTOL
Bishopsworth
CHURCH ROAD (West side)
No.60 School House and attached schoolrooms

(Formerly Listed as: CHURCH ROAD, Bishopswith No.60 School House)
04/03/77

GV
II
House and school. c1840. Random rubble with ashlar dressings, stone end stacks and pantile roof. Single-depth plan. Tudor Revival style. Two storeys; three window range. Gabled cross wing projects from the right, with an entrance to the left; two mullion windows in the ground floor and three in the first, all with cast-iron lattice casements. Stack projects from both gables; single storey catslide.

INTERIOR: central winder stair in entrance hall.
